py ajax运行后页面会刷新
时间: 2024-05-15 21:12:34 浏览: 42
如果你在使用 Ajax 进行异步请求时,页面出现了刷新的情况,可能是因为你没有阻止表单的默认提交行为。
你可以在 jQuery 中使用 `preventDefault()` 方法来阻止表单的默认提交行为。例如:
```javascript
$(document).ready(function(){
$("form").submit(function(event){
event.preventDefault(); // 阻止表单默认提交行为
$.ajax({
url: "your_url",
type: "POST",
data: $(this).serialize(),
success: function(response){
// 处理响应数据
}
});
});
});
```
在上面的例子中,我们使用 `preventDefault()` 方法阻止表单的默认提交行为,并使用 `$.ajax()` 方法来发送异步请求。在响应成功后,我们可以对响应数据进行处理。
阅读全文